[PATCH] common: handle ceph's new mount syntax

Cephfs is introducing a new mount device syntax. Fix the fstests
infrastructure to handle the new syntax correctly.

---
 common/config |  2 +-
 common/rc     | 34 ++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++--
 2 files changed, 33 insertions(+), 3 deletions(-)

diff --git a/common/config b/common/config
index e0a5c5df58ff..be97436b0857 100644
--- a/common/config
+++ b/common/config
@@ -533,7 +533,7 @@ _check_device()
 	fi
 
 	case "$FSTYP" in
-	9p|tmpfs|virtiofs)
+	9p|tmpfs|virtiofs|ceph)
 		# 9p and virtiofs mount tags are just plain strings, so anything is allowed
 		# tmpfs doesn't use mount source, ignore
 		;;
diff --git a/common/rc b/common/rc
index 7973ceb5fdf8..4fa0b818d840 100644
--- a/common/rc
+++ b/common/rc
@@ -1592,7 +1592,7 @@ _require_scratch_nocheck()
 			_notrun "this test requires a valid \$SCRATCH_MNT"
 		fi
 		;;
-	nfs*|ceph)
+	nfs*)
 		echo $SCRATCH_DEV | grep -q ":/" > /dev/null 2>&1
 		if [ -z "$SCRATCH_DEV" -o "$?" != "0" ]; then
 			_notrun "this test requires a valid \$SCRATCH_DEV"
@@ -1601,6 +1601,21 @@ _require_scratch_nocheck()
 			_notrun "this test requires a valid \$SCRATCH_MNT"
 		fi
 		;;
+	ceph)
+		if [ -z "$SCRATCH_DEV" ]; then
+			_notrun "this test requires a valid \$SCRATCH_DEV"
+		fi
+		echo $SCRATCH_DEV | grep -q "=/" > /dev/null 2>&1
+		if [ "$?" != "0" ]; then
+			echo $SCRATCH_DEV | grep -q ":/" > /dev/null 2>&1
+			if [ "$?" != "0" ]; then
+				_notrun "this test requires a valid \$SCRATCH_DEV"
+			fi
+		fi
+		if [ ! -d "$SCRATCH_MNT" ]; then
+			_notrun "this test requires a valid \$SCRATCH_MNT"
+		fi
+		;;
 	pvfs2)
 		echo $SCRATCH_DEV | grep -q "://" > /dev/null 2>&1
 		if [ -z "$SCRATCH_DEV" -o "$?" != "0" ]; then
@@ -1770,7 +1785,7 @@ _require_test()
 			_notrun "this test requires a valid \$TEST_DIR"
 		fi
 		;;
-	nfs*|ceph)
+	nfs*)
 		echo $TEST_DEV | grep -q ":/" > /dev/null 2>&1
 		if [ -z "$TEST_DEV" -o "$?" != "0" ]; then
 			_notrun "this test requires a valid \$TEST_DEV"
@@ -1779,6 +1794,21 @@ _require_test()
 			_notrun "this test requires a valid \$TEST_DIR"
 		fi
 		;;
+	ceph)
+		if [ -z "$TEST_DEV" ]; then
+			_notrun "this test requires a valid \$TEST_DEV"
+		fi
+		echo $TEST_DEV | grep -q "=/" > /dev/null 2>&1
+		if [ "$?" != "0" ]; then
+			echo $TEST_DEV | grep -q ":/" > /dev/null 2>&1
+			if [ "$?" != "0" ]; then
+				_notrun "this test requires a valid \$TEST_DEV"
+			fi
+		fi
+		if [ ! -d "$TEST_DIR" ]; then
+			_notrun "this test requires a valid \$TEST_DIR"
+		fi
+		;;
 	cifs)
 		echo $TEST_DEV | grep -q "//" > /dev/null 2>&1
 		if [ -z "$TEST_DEV" -o "$?" != "0" ]; then
